Qualification
Subscribers are eligible for the program if their income is 135% or less than the Federal Poverty Guidelines, or if they are enrolled in these assistance programs::
-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), formerly known as Food Stamps
- Medicaid
- Supplemental Security Income (SSI)
- Federal Public Housing Assistance (FPHA)
- Veterans Pension and Survivors Benefit
- Bureau of Indian Affairs General Assistance (BIA)
- Tribal Head Start If you meet the income qualifying standards
- Tribal Administered Temporary Assistance for Needy Families
- Food Distribution Program on Indian Reservations (FDPIR)


Special plans
Exclusive Plans for States (Excluding California)
We offer a variety of mobile plans tailored to meet the needs of our customers outside of California. These plans are designed to provide flexibility based on your usage preferences, whether you prioritize data, voice minutes, or text messaging.
Text, Data, and Free Talk Plan
This plan includes 500MB of mobile data, 100 voice minutes each month, and unlimited text messaging. If you find that you typically use more data than voice minutes, this plan would be ideal for you. It’s structured to accommodate users who engage more in data-heavy activities while still allowing for a reasonable amount of voice communication.
Text and Free Talk Plan
This option offers unlimited text messages, along with 500 free voice minutes, and a modest 50MB of data each month. This plan suits users with minimal data requirements. However, please note that 50MB may not suffice for heavy internet usage, so it is best for those who primarily use texting and voice calls.
Text, Data, Free Talk, and State Fund Plan (Smartphone users in OR, NE, or KY)
For smartphone users in Oregon, Nebraska, or Kentucky, this plan provides 500MB of data, 300 voice minutes, and unlimited text messaging. This package is designed to meet the needs of users who want a balanced mix of data, voice, and text communication.
Text, Free Talk, with State Funds (Feature phone users in OR, NE, or KY)
This plan caters to feature phone users in Oregon, Nebraska, or Kentucky, offering 500MB of data, 350 voice minutes, and unlimited text messages. It ensures that users with basic phones can still enjoy a comprehensive communication package that meets their needs.
California Plans
If you reside in California, you have access to enhanced mobile plans that provide greater value. The complimentary plan includes 100 voice minutes and unlimited text messaging, which is four times more than what is offered in standard plans for other states. Additionally, you will receive 200MB of data each month.
Upgraded California Plan
For just an extra $10 per month, you can upgrade to a plan that includes unlimited texting and voice calling, in addition to 500MB of data. This plan is perfect for those who require extensive communication capabilities without worrying about data limits.
Additional California Plans
We also provide various other plans in California, with prices ranging from $5 to $25 per month. These plans cater to different usage patterns and budgets, ensuring that all customers can find an option that suits their specific needs.
